The client/cloud server communication is completed using the following ports. To ensure proper communication to the cloud portal please make sure all ports below are open and also the whitelisting of *.avast.com
-
http/80 (updates)
-
https/443 (FFL encryption key negotiation)
-
TCP, UDP/ 443, 53 for secure DNS
-
*.avast.com
-
77.234.40.0/21 Update servers
Repair Avast
- Save and close/exit/quit all open software programs/work
- Open Control Panel
- Go into Add/Remove Programs or Programs and Features
- Select Avast product
- Click the “Uninstall/Change” button
- Click the “Repair” in the left panel
- Click the “Next” button
- Repairing may take several minutes
- Select “Restart”
- Click the “Finish” button to restart computer immediately
Clean Reinstall Avast
- Save and close/exit/quit all open software programs/work
- Open Control Panel
- Go into Add/Remove Programs or Programs and Features
- Select Avast product
- Click the “Uninstall/Change” button
- Click the “Uninstall” in the left panel
- Click the “Next” button
- Uninstalling may take several minutes
- Select “Restart”
- Click the “Finish” button to restart computer immediately
- Download/run the Avast Uninstall Utility at https://www.avast.com/uninstall-utility
- Restart computer again
- Open “Program Files”, “Program Files (x86)”, and “ProgramData” folders and verify all Avast subfolders have been deleted.
- Log into https://business.avast.com
- Click on the “Add new devices” button
- Click on “Advanced settings”
- Select desired “Installer type”
- Choose desired options (we recommend selecting “Full (device can be offline when installing)”
- Click the “Download” button
- After downloading and before installing Avast, right-click on the file and select "Properties". If there is a Security option at the bottom, please unblock the program as shown in the screenshot below:
